Uttar Pradesh assembly election, Mar 2012
403 assembly constituencies in Uttar Pradesh, 59.48% turnout.
Party performance
Ordered by seats won in Uttar Pradesh
| Party | Won | +/− | Contested | Votes | Share | Share +/− |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| SPSamajwadi Party | 224 | +127 | 401 | 2,20,90,571 | 29.13% | +3.70 |
| BSPBahujan Samaj Party | 80 | -126 | 403 | 1,96,47,303 | 25.91% | -4.52 |
| BJPBharatiya Janata Party | 47 | -4 | 398 | 1,13,71,080 | 15.00% | -1.97 |
| INCIndian National Congress | 28 | +6 | 355 | 88,32,895 | 11.65% | +3.04 |
| RLDRashtriya Lok Dal | 9 | -1 | 46 | 17,63,354 | 2.33% | -1.37 |
| INDIndependent | 6 | -3 | 1691 | 31,34,336 | 4.13% | -2.83 |
| PECPPECP | 4 | +4 | 208 | 17,84,258 | 2.35% | — |
| QEDQED | 2 | +2 | 43 | 4,17,552 | 0.55% | — |
| ADAD | 1 | +1 | 76 | 6,78,924 | 0.90% | -0.16 |
| NCPNationalist Congress Party | 1 | +1 | 127 | 2,48,283 | 0.33% | +0.23 |

Who won the Uttar Pradesh assembly election, Mar 2012?
Samajwadi Party won 224 of 403 seats in Uttar Pradesh, a clear majority.
What was the voter turnout in the Uttar Pradesh assembly election, Mar 2012?
Turnout was 59.48% — 7.58 cr of 12.7 cr registered electors voted.
How many assembly seats does Uttar Pradesh have?
Uttar Pradesh has 403 assembly seats.
